Idaho Falls, Idaho Housing tenure**

Renter occupied housing units 8,847
Owner occupied housing units 15,077

Renters take up 37% of Idaho Falls, Idaho real estate, occupying a total of 8,847 units, while homeowners live in 15,077 properties.

Idaho Falls, Idaho Renter-occupied housing units by no. of bedrooms**

No bedrooms 426
1 bed 1,941
2 beds 4,102
3 beds 1,471
4 beds 561
5 or more beds 346

There are 4,102 rentals in Idaho Falls, Idaho with 2 beds making up the highest share of the market, at 46%. Units with 5 or more beds, on the other hand, hold the lowest percentage (4%), amounting to 346 units. Overall, the median number of rooms in Idaho Falls, Idaho homes for rent is 4.2.

Idaho Falls, Idaho Renter-occupied units by age of householder**

15 - 24 years 1,258
25 - 34 years 2,483
35 - 44 years 1,574
45 - 54 years 976
55 - 59 years 841
60 - 64 years 461
65 - 74 years 591
75 - 84 years 374
85 years and over 289

Most condos for rent in Idaho Falls, Idaho are occupied by residents in the 25 - 34 years age group (28%), followed by those in the 35 - 44 years age group (18%). At the same time, people in the 85 years and over age group make up the lowest share of the local rental market – 3%.

Idaho Falls, Idaho Renter-occupied units by year structure built**

Built 2010 - 2019 738
Built 2000 - 2009 953
Built 1990 - 1999 1,106
Built 1980 - 1989 924
Built 1970 - 1979 1,685
Built 1960 - 1969 920
Built 1950 - 1959 1,152
Built 1940 - 1949 307
Built 1939 or earlier 1,042

The highest share of Idaho Falls, Idaho apartment rentals, namely 19% or 1,685 units, were Built 1970 - 1979, followed by those Built 1950 - 1959 (13%, 1,152 units), and the ones Built 1990 - 1999 (13%, 1,106 units).
